find calorie/fitness calculator on the net, enter all your stats and it will tell you how many calories you need a day to maintain, take off 300-400cal off that number and thats how much you need to lose.eat 5-6 small meals a day (eat every 2-3 hours)5-8 servings of fruit and veggies a day8 glasses of waterhave complex carbs for breakfast - they give you energyhave lean meat (protein) for dinner - repairs musclecardio exercise 4-6 times a week for 30-50min, light weight trainingdont consume foods that are made of white flour (white bread, cakes, past etc.), sugar loaded foods (cookies, icecream, candy etc) and nothing fried, oily.ofcourse you can spoil yourself once in a while with a little treat:)
